About the role

The Agentic Operations and Intelligence Consultant is responsible for driving strategic deals and transforming operations through process automation solutions. This role requires 10+ years of experience in technical sales, solutions engineering, or related fields, with expertise in industries such as financial services, healthcare, supply chain, or public sector.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the primary solution leader on complex deals, pitching the vision of autonomous business processes and defining multi-year value roadmaps for strategic customers.
  • Define and pitch a multi-year "Value Roadmap" for customers, moving beyond a single use case to demonstrate how Agentforce can transform their entire operations.
  • Act as the primary subject matter expert (SME) in C-suite presentations, translating technical "Agentic" capabilities into business outcomes like working capital optimization and risk mitigation.
  • Lead and manage 4–5 week POC engagements, focusing on proving the business case and securing technical buy-in to close deals.
  • Partner with Product and Engineering teams to provide real-world feedback, ensuring the Regrello roadmap aligns with the "big rock" problems being solved in the field.
  • Drive revenue growth as part of a commissionable team, taking accountability for deal velocity and win rates within the Regrello/Apromore portfolio.

Requirements

  • Deep industry experience in one of the following: Financial Services, Healthcare & Life Sciences, Supply Chain, or Public Sector.
  • Familiarity with supply chain management, financial services, or workflow automation platforms.
  • Proven ability to lead "whiteboard" sessions that challenge a customer's current state and build a compelling vision for a future state.
  • Ability to "roll up sleeves" and configure solutions (POCs) using no-code tools, always through the lens of solving a specific business problem.
  • Exceptional ability to communicate complex AI and automation concepts to stakeholders ranging from Warehouse Managers to Chief Supply Chain Officers.
  • Experience working in or alongside quota-carrying roles with MBO or KSO-based incentive structures.
